Output 6b3abdb9fce30f1f62c4fde1892fa5da7831a837e17660ca5d4e14fee8139c60:0

value
6965421031382
script pubkey
OP_0 OP_PUSHBYTES_20 fd27a3a1b370bd20323bbe115c8ec8e280bc4f55
address
tb1ql5n68gdnwz7jqv3mhcg4erkgu2qtcn64mkqg78
transaction
6b3abdb9fce30f1f62c4fde1892fa5da7831a837e17660ca5d4e14fee8139c60
confirmations
171484
spent
true